The Island Country Inn certainly has a few things going for it, but needs to focus on a couple major shortcomings. In the good column, location is great, price is reasonable, and the front desk staff are gracious and helpful. In the "needs improvement" column, the mattresses desperately need to be replaced. They're soft and sagging, and long overdue for replacement. While we were able to get to sleep, we awoke with sore backs each day. The linens and bedspreads are also old, worn, and dirty. I found numerous hairs on my pillowcase. Management provided new, clean pillowcases immediately, and said they had a problem with their laundry machine. The hotel is generally dated and tired. Bathroom in our "suite" was tiny, though functional. Continental Breakfast was provided, but was very basic. A few cold cereals, toast, and a Belgian waffle-maker. They do provide hard-boiled eggs, which was nice. The dining area is pretty cramped and difficult to navigate. I would expect a place like Bainbridge Island to have at least one business-class hotel. This is really an old motel that needs quite a bit of work. Next time, we'll try the Best Western across the street. « less
